Warning Signs You Need Trim and Baseboard Replacement After Water Damage
Ignoring the warning sign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s down the line. It’s essential to catch these signs early on to prevent bigger problems.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
You smell mildew or musty odors in your home. If you notice a persistent smell that refuses to go away, it’s a sign that water has seeped into your walls or baseboards.
Warped or Discolored Trim and Baseboards
Your trim and baseboards are warped or discolored. If you notice any changes in color or warping, it’s a sign that water has damaged the materials.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
You see water stains on your ceiling or walls. If you notice any water stains, it’s a sign that water has seeped into your walls or ceiling.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Your paint or wallpaper is peeling. If you notice any peeling paint or wallpaper, it’s a sign that water has damaged the underlying materials.
Musty Smells Coming from Your Electrical Outlets
You smell mildew coming from your electrical outlets. If you notice any musty smells coming from your electrical outlets, it’s a sign that water has seeped into your walls or baseboards.

Trim & Baseboard Replacement After Water Damage Cost In Mesa, AZ
The cost of trim and baseboard replacement after water damage var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Mesa, AZ.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Trim and Baseboard Replacement |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the materials needed. |
| Moisture Reading and Inspection | $100 – $500 | The extent of the damage and the number of areas inspected. |
| Drying Equipment Setup and Removal |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to all our customers.
